Zone 5 Technologies Corporate Profile and Background

Zone 5 Technologies began as a small, privately held company built on real aerospace know-how and clear vision. A group of seasoned flight technology experts leads the team, using their hands-on experience and smart planning to help the company stand out in defense and aerospace.

Their operations run from a modern 20,000 square-foot space near the regional airport in San Luis Obispo. In this facility, engineering, making parts, and putting them together all happen under one roof. This setup helps speed up development and allows for quick testing and prototyping. Plus, by teaming up with local universities, cleantech incubators, and industry partners, they mix deep technical knowledge with practical work.

Zone 5 Technologies Advanced Aerial Drone Solutions and Product Portfolio

img-1.jpg

Zone 5 Technologies is taking aerial defense to new heights with a lineup that mixes rapid prototyping, modular design, and smart, cost-efficient production. They offer unmanned air vehicles equipped with a palletized munition weapon system and tailored precision UAS platforms. Each product is built to let you swap out payloads quickly, making it easy to jump from design to deployment while keeping up with today’s defense demands.

Product Key Features Development Status
Enterprise Test Vehicle Modular design, palletized munition interface, rapid prototyping Developed jointly with Anduril Industries
Custom Precision UAS Platform Advanced sensor fusion, high-performance computing, precision targeting In advanced testing phase
Interchangeable Payload Interface System Flexible design, scalable integration, cost-effective production Prototype stage
